Dream car - nightmare purchase

Initial contact with the salesman was great, and negotiation was fair, but after that, service went down hill. No service history ever provided despite repeatedly asking, no invoice until asked 3 times, no confirmation of funds received for 48 hours, car not prepared as agreed and arrived with scuffed wheels which i now have to rectify (at their expense). Dealer couldn't even be bothered to submit the V5 to the DVLA and didn't bother telling me until i found the V5 in the service book! The worst part is that the dealer very happy to supply a supercar with rear brake discs well below manufacturers recommended standard, despite being made aware of this on multiple occasions. Having raised concerns to 4 levels of management, I received a terse and dismissive response from the DP. I accept that COVID has presented challenging times, but this has been awful. A few bumps along the way is understandable - but when almost the entire transaction is this bad, it's shameful.
